Where We Are

The village of Malcolm, located about 10 miles northwest of Nebraska’s capital city has a population of 480. The village is surrounded by farms and acreages and the Branched Oak Lake state recreation area just three miles to the north. As a bedroom community to Lincoln, most of Malcolm’s residents, if not farmers or employees of the school district, commute to Lincoln for work. The Pre-K through high school enrollment of Malcolm Public Schools is around 640 students. The average class size is between 50-55 students.

Who We Are

 

Affiliated with the Berean Fellowship of Churches, Northwest Community Church was founded in 1988 with a passion for reaching northwest Lancaster County (Nebraska) and the surrounding area with the Gospel of Christ while making disciples through Biblical instruction.

Our current staff includes a part-time Executive Pastor, a full-time Youth Pastor and a secretary.

Nearly 90 families call NCC home. With just under 100 members, the church has an average Sunday morning attendance of 155 with nearly 100 attending Sunday school on a weekly basis.

NCC has a strong reputation for serving children and youth in the community. Our Wednesday after school children’s ministry averages 130 students while our Wednesday night youth ministry reaches more than 80 students on a weekly basis.

NCC has active women’s and men’s ministries. We also have a number of growth groups that meet regularly.

NCC supports eight missionary families that are boldly sharing God’s truth globally and domestically.
